Special interests: women’s health and paediatrics

Dr Jane Healy graduated from University of Tasmania in 2001 and obtained her fellowship in RACGP in 2008. She worked in both general practice and in the education of medical students in Tasmania before moving to Melbourne and joining GIMG in 2009. Jane became a partner of the practice in 2014.

Jane enjoys all aspects of general practice but has a special interest in paediatrics, adolescent health and women’s health. She works with local schools, providing information sessions and open discussion for students around common health topics.
